This will 'disappoint' Valentino Lazaro at Newcastle United

Valentino Lazaro will be “disappointed” at a lack of game time at Newcastle United, according to Steve Bruce.

Lazaro, signed on loan from Inter Milan in January, has played just 383 minutes of Premier League football for the club.

And United must soon make decisions on Lazaro and his fellow loanees, Nabil Bentaleb and Danny Rose, ahead of the summer transfer window.

Bruce spoke about Lazaro after last night's goalless draw against Brighton and Hove Albion. The 24-year-old came off the bench late in the game at the Amex Stadium.

Asked about Lazaro’s situation, Newcastle’s head coach said: “It’s been really difficult, because of the lockdown situation. He probably hasn’t played as much as he would like.

"I think he’s just getting used to playing in the Premier League, but now its finishing. I’m sure he’ll be disappointed with the amount of game time he’s had, but, look, up until two, three games ago, the team were playing very, very well, and he couldn’t find his way into it.

"So it’s been difficult for the boy, but I still like him as a player and as a lad. He’ll look at the game time, and think he hasn’t had enough.”

It would reportedly cost United £20million to make Lazaro’s move permanent.

The Brighton result left the club 13th in the Premier League with one game to play. Newcastle entertain champions Liverpool at St James’s Park on Sunday.
